## Releases

The CrumbClock service enforces the order-cutoff rule: orders placed after 2 p.m. roll to the next bake day. Releases go out Mondays before cutoff to avoid mid-window rule changes. Build with make release and run the cutoff test suite. Before uploading, sign the artifact with the key below.

release key, kawif-hawep: bky13_X7TGuRG4Zu4ZJ

Subject: Invoice renderer handoff notes

For future maintainers: the Paperlane PDF invoice renderer now lives in the billing-core repo under render/invoice. It embeds fonts at build time, so any font change requires a full rebuild. Tax-line wrapping was fixed by Edda in the last cycle; do not revert the layout pass order. The renderer was last verified against the build below.

build token for yajof-bajof: htk31_506ff1188f74596b5bb2eec94edc43c

## Further Reading

Before touching the legacy Marrowgate ORM layer, please read the background material carefully. The refactor replaces hand-rolled query builders with the Tiderow mapper, and several modules still straddle both worlds. The migration guide explains which entities have been converted, which are frozen pending the Q3 cutover, and the naming conventions that keep the two systems from colliding. It also covers rollback steps if a converted entity misbehaves. The full guide lives at the internal page linked below.

operations page: https://jenkins.zemvarcloud.local/job/merge_requests/repo/build/73930b4b30f0a8ed

## Releases

Post the Quillhaven stale-cache incident (postmortem PM-stale-edge), every release now invalidates edge caches before artifact promotion; the old flow promoted first, which let stale bundles serve for up to 40 minutes. Release steps: tag, build, invalidate, promote, verify. No manual cache flushes — the pipeline does it or the release fails. Every promoted artifact must verify against the current release signing key; reviewers should confirm the published bundles check out against the key shown below.

rollout seal: bky9_PeXH1fTLY